King, James Kevin
Personal Information
Rank | Sgt |
Forename(s) | James Kevin |
Surname | King |
Gender | M |
Age | 24 |
Decorations | |
Date of Death | 10-09-1942 |
Next of Kin | Son of Edward John and Elizabeth King, of Midlands Junction, Western Australia. |
Aircraft Information
Aircraft | Vickers Wellington IV |
Serial Number | Z1216 |
Markings | UV-S |
Memorial Information
Burial/Memorial Country | Germany |
Burial/Memorial Place | Rheinberg War Cemetery |
Grave Reference | 4. A. 8. |
Epitaph | HIS DUTY NOBLY DONE, REVERING OUR DEAR SON. EVER REMEMBERED |
IBCC Memorial Information
Phase | 1 |
Panel Number | 59 |
Enlistment Information
Service Number | 406980 |
Service | Royal Australian Air Force |
Group | 1 |
Squadron | 460 (Australian) |
Trade | Air Gunner |
Country of Origin | Australia |

Last Operation Information
Start Date | 10-09-1942 |
End Date | 11-09-1942 |
Takeoff Station | Breighton |
Day/Night Raid | Night (0% moon) |
Operation | Dusseldorf |
Reason for Loss | Crashed near Koln, reason unknown. |
